可以使用循環來遍歷數組或者列表中的元素,比較每個元素的大小,找到最大值。
以下是一個示例代碼:
#include <stdio.h>
int main() {
int arr[] = {10, 5, 8, 15, 3};
int size = sizeof(arr) / sizeof(arr[0]);
int max = arr[0];
for (int i = 1; i < size; i++) {
if (arr[i] > max) {
max = arr[i];
}
}
printf("最大值為:%d\n", max);
return 0;
}
該程序首先定義了一個整型數組arr
,然后通過計算數組長度確定循環次數。接下來,使用一個變量max
來存儲最大值,初始值為數組的第一個元素。然后,使用循環從數組的第二個元素開始依次與max
比較,如果當前元素比max
大,則更新max
的值。循環結束后,max
即為數組中的最大值。最后,使用printf
函數輸出最大值。
以上代碼輸出結果為:最大值為:15